## TICKET-2291: Signature check failing on relevance-tuning config push

For the weekly sync: pushes of the search relevance tuning notes (boost weights for the Farrowmere index) are being rejected by the config service with a bad-signature error since Tuesday. Root cause looks like the deploy pipeline still signing with the key retired during last month's rotation. Reverting isn't an option — the new weights fix the synonym regression. Pipelines should be updated to sign with the current key, reproduced here for verification.

signing key of bagap-yawep = bky13_TbfT6ZMUoGJo2

Subject: DR drill Friday — timing-chip readers

Support team,

This Friday we run the quarterly disaster-recovery drill for the Stridepace timing-chip readers. We will power down the primary mat controllers at the simulated finish line and confirm that the backup readers pick up chip reads without gaps. Expect test tickets in the queue; tag them with the drill label and do not escalate. If the backup console asks for authentication, enter the recovery passphrase below.

unlock words, yawig-kagef: gordor-holvan-ulaael-pramir-ulaiel-tamdor

Handover — Fennick Catalogue Import

Welcome aboard. The nightly import pulls MARC records from the Quillmere Archive feed into Shelfwright. Watch for duplicate accession rows; the dedupe pass runs before indexing, not after. Rollbacks are safe — staging tables are kept for seven days. The importer reads the following configuration values at startup.

settings of tajep-tafog:
CASDOR_LOG_LEVEL=info
CASDOR_METRICS_HOST=metrics.casdor.nelvrosys.internal
CASDOR_POOL_SIZE=16

Leadership Review Briefing — FY Headcount

Quick summary for finance ahead of Thursday's session. Next year's plan adds 34 roles overall: most land in the Delvane engineering group, a handful in customer success, and two in legal. Backfill approvals stay centralized through the quarter. We're holding sales flat until the Merrow pipeline firms up. Comp assumptions are in the shared model. For context on why we're leaning this way, see the note below.

board note of baweg-bawig: Project Tamath slips by six weeks because of the audit delay.